Description and Duties
The Finishes Manager is charged with the following duties:
- Ensuring that all works on site are carried in accordance with the specification or in accordance with some other acceptable standard if no specification exists or is otherwise directed by his superiors.
- Ensuring that the quality of all works carried on site is acceptable and in accordance with the specification.
- Ensuring that all resources required for the timely and proper carrying out of the works are available to him.
- Ensuring that all resources of PECL and all subcontractors employed by PECL are used in a productive way at all times.
- Ensuring that his site is safe and that all accident prevention measures are taken in a good and timely manner.
- Ensuring all Quality procedures and Control sheets are followed and completed daily.
- Meeting weekly with the project team and subcontractors to ensure programme, quality and health and safety standards are met.
- Generate a pre handover snag list for completion by all relevant subcontractors. Ensuring subcontractors complete the snag list price to handover in accordance with the programme.
- Ensuring that works are carried out in the most cost efficient manner as possible, paying particular attention to preliminary and overhead costs.
The Finishes Manager shall be responsible for obtaining the information necessary from design teams and subcontractors in order to carry out the works in accordance with the programme and quality standards.
